Acerca de
Derek W. Wade is a collaboration expert and organizational coach at Kumido Adaptive Strategies. He has measurably improved hundreds of group efforts, especially those leveraging distributed teams. Derek is the author of Multidimensional Management: Avoiding Calcification or Fragmentation on Distributed Teams (with J. Puopolo) and Emergent Design: Leveraging Agile Retrospectives to Evolve Your Architecture (with Scott Barnes).
Specialties: Derek has been a Kanban Coaching Professional (KCP), Accredited Kanban Trainer (AKT), Certified Scrum Professional (CSP), Innovation Games™ Qualified Instructor, Core Passion Authorized Facilitator, and holds FAA instructor and pilot licenses.
